Free Press is Good Press!
Written by Chris on September 21, 2006 – 7:56 pm -I just wanted to give everyone a quick update on what is going on and appologize for the lack of posting!
School work has been kicking my butt recently and then on top of that the different organizations that I am involved in have been taking up a lot of time. So once I do get home from campus, I am doing work until 2 AM and don’t have much time to post on here. But hopefully that will change soon.
Anyway, a couple weeks ago I had an interview with the school newspaper for an article on Radford Auctions, my eBay start-up business. Well, it was finally published on Wednesday
You can read the article here.
The publishing of the article got delayed because the editor had a few extra questions but overall, it turned out pretty good. There was one minor mistake made, he mentioned that my partner, Zach, and I are roommates. But, in fact, we are not, we just run the business out of our respective apartments.
Now, normally most people would probably demand a reprint or something along those lines for a mistake in a newspaper, but when you are just starting out your business, you can not complain about free press. This article will hopefully lead to another one in my partner’s school newspaper which goes out to many more students then the one here at Radford does. The great thing about free press, is that, well, its FREE. The article appeared front page and then also continued on the inside, and I was very impressed by this. I figured it would have shown up at the very back of the paper or hidden somewhere else.
So, my lesson for all of you to learn today is to accept any free press you get (whether it is good or possibly bad, its still press) and do not stress over little minor mistakes such as this one if it really is just minor.
